Output 94743ef07972390d8277564b0a614ca193b51041663bd351c4250b316f421628:2

value
40763085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e809d2882a875f08104d41547ef320e1f37793a OP_EQUAL
address
MX6qwQUNyLgxXrM8KvXNtCQ3yvHAYUUUVW
transaction
94743ef07972390d8277564b0a614ca193b51041663bd351c4250b316f421628
spent
true